Nottingham Forest suffered a bitterly-disappointing defeat at the City Ground on Friday night as Newcastle United scored late goals in both halves to claim a 2-1 win.
The Reds’ nine-game unbeaten run at home came to an end as their hopes of Premier League survial were dealt a blow ahead of the international break.
Alexander Isak scored a stoppage-time penalty after drawing the Magpies level during the first half as he cancelled out Emmanuel Dennis’ brilliantly-taken opener.
Forest are 14th in the table, two points above the bottom three, with a number of their relegation rivals in action on Saturday and Sunday.
Here’s how reporter Max Scott rated the Forest players after Friday’s loss to The Magpies.
1. Keylor Navas - 6
Nothing could be done about the first goal - a superb finish from Isak. Fabulous save
from an Anderson volley early in the second half. Last- minute penalty save wasn’t to be.
2. Serge Aurier - 6
Couple of sloppy passes and crosses in the first 20 minutes. But his effort couldn’t be faulted. Another solid performance from the Ivorian.
3. Felipe - 7
Calm on the ball. Made some important tackles in that first half and continued his solid form in a Forest shirt. Crucial block from a close-range Bruno Guimares effort in the closing stages.
4. Moussa Niakhate - 5
Niakhate’s added pace gave Forest a bit more assurance at the back but he lacked
match sharpness. Looked to be frustrated with the lack of service from Navas. Bizarre jumping technique which lead to the crucial penalty.
